Weather stripping refers to the material used to seal gaps and openings around windows, doors, and other areas of a building's exterior. It acts as a barrier against external elements, such as wind, rain, and cold temperatures, effectively preventing drafts from entering the home. When properly installed, weather stripping can provide significant insulation benefits and improve the overall energy efficiency of a property.

Stair edge nosing trim is a strip that is applied to the front edge of a stair tread. It comes in various shapes, sizes, and materials to accommodate different flooring designs and styles. The primary purpose of stair nosing is to create a visual contrast between the tread and the riser or adjacent surfaces. This contrast is crucial in preventing accidents, especially in low-light conditions or on stairs with similar-colored treads and risers.

1. Protection Against Moisture Penetration One of the most significant benefits of using drainage mats is their ability to prevent moisture from penetrating the foundation walls. Excess moisture can lead to a range of issues, including mold growth, foundation cracking, and overall structural damage. By effectively channeling water away from the foundation, drainage mats help maintain a dry and stable environment.

One of the primary determinants of agricultural building prices is construction materials. The type and quality of materials used directly influence the overall cost. Traditional materials like wood and metal have unique benefits and drawbacks. For instance, wooden structures may offer better insulation but require more maintenance over time. Conversely, metal buildings are often more durable and easier to erect, yet may involve higher upfront costs. Additionally, the rising prices of raw materials, influenced by global market trends and supply chain disruptions, can significantly impact costs.

Steel structure warehouse is more economical than conventional buildings. The construction process is relatively simple; the prefabricated steel structure’s construction process is usually not as easy to delay the construction period of other facilities. All drilling, cutting, and welding are carried out in the factory, and then the parts are transported to the construction site for installation. Since only the parts are assembled on-site, there is almost no other cost increase.

Steel, known for its unparalleled strength-to-weight ratio, is an ideal choice for various construction projects. Whether it's skyscrapers, bridges, warehouses, or residential buildings, steel structures offer the ability to span larger distances with fewer supports, allowing for more open and flexible interior spaces. Steel building construction companies specialize in the design, fabrication, and erection of these steel frameworks, ensuring that they meet the highest standards of safety and durability.

Consider not only the amount of materials you are looking to warehouse, but the equipment you’ll need to handle your inventory. Your need for interior clearance may mean that you’ll require a custom building with more height than our standard 40-foot prefabricated structure. The doors will also need to accommodate that equipment moving in and out.

Another significant advantage is the speed of construction. Steel components can be prefabricated off-site, allowing for quicker assembly on location. Often, this results in less time spent on-site, minimizing disruption for the homeowners and surrounding community. The precision involved in modern steel fabrication also ensures a higher degree of accuracy in construction, leading to fewer structural issues down the line.

Before you dive into the construction process, the first step is planning. Assess your needs and determine the purpose of your shed. Consider the size based on what you plan to store inside. Common sizes range from small utility sheds to larger workshop spaces. Next, check local building codes and zoning regulations, as some areas require permits for structure construction.
